deck flooring for boats
Deck flooring for boats represents a crucial component in marine vessel construction, combining functionality, safety, and aesthetic appeal. This specialized flooring system is engineered to withstand the harsh marine environment while providing secure footing for passengers and crew. Modern boat deck flooring incorporates advanced materials such as marine-grade synthetic teak, composite materials, and treated hardwoods, each designed to resist water damage, UV radiation, and daily wear. The flooring systems feature innovative non-slip textures and patterns that maintain grip even in wet conditions, crucial for safety at sea. Installation methods have evolved to include modular systems that allow for easy replacement and maintenance, reducing downtime and maintenance costs. These deck solutions often integrate seamlessly with existing boat structures, providing excellent thermal insulation and noise reduction properties. Contemporary deck flooring also incorporates drainage channels and water management systems to prevent pooling and maintain a dry surface. The materials used are specifically chosen for their resistance to saltwater corrosion, mold growth, and staining, ensuring long-term durability in marine conditions. Modern boat deck flooring solutions also consider environmental impact, with many manufacturers now offering sustainable options that maintain high performance standards while reducing ecological footprint.
